A Pinard horn is a simple, curved device used in obstetrics to amplify fetal heart sounds during pregnancy. It consists of a long, funnel-shaped tube that directs sound waves from the mother's abdomen to the listener's ear. The practitioner places the large end of the horn on the mother's belly and listens through the smaller end, allowing them to hear the fetal heartbeat more clearly. This tool is particularly useful in settings where electronic fetal monitors are unavailable.
